## Deployment

LinkWeave handles deep-link routing for the Pebblenest mobile apps. Deploys go out via the Harbinger pipeline — push to main, wait for the green tick, done. Support folks: if users report links opening the wrong screen, it's almost always a stale routing table in prod, not the app itself. A redeploy refreshes it. For reference, the current production settings are shown below.

settings of yahag-yafog:
[pramir]
host = pramir.qirvancorp.internal
user = pramir_svc
database = pramir_prod

# Driver-assignment heuristic (RouteHive dispatch)
# New folks: this block controls how we pick a driver for each order.
# We score candidates on distance, current load, and recent decline rate,
# then take the top score with a small random tiebreaker to avoid
# starving anyone. Weights below are tuned weekly — don't change them
# without a dispatch review. The scorer reads driver state from the
# database reachable at the following:

replica DSN, kajep-yahag: mssql://praok_svc:iF@db-8d68.plorvaio.local:5432/eliion

Ticket #4417 — Expired credentials on BloomGate. The bloom filter service that screens lookups before they hit the Cairnstore key-value cluster stopped authenticating at 03:12. Its service credential lapsed because auto-renewal was never enabled for this account. All reads are currently passing through unfiltered, raising Cairnstore load. Until renewal is fixed, BloomGate should be restarted with the replacement key provided below.

gateway credential: kto3_qfe

Subject: Renewal — Torvane Supply Agreement

Department heads, the Torvane contract expires in ninety days. Their proposed terms raise unit costs 6% but add a volume rebate tier that likely nets us ahead at current run rates. Legal has flagged two clauses for revision. Before we respond, please review the confidential context provided below.

confidential, kagep-kahof: Druokax Systems plans to lower the Ulaath list price by 53 percent in March.